Selenium’s official site states, “Selenium automates browsers. That’s it!” But there’s more – Selenium and the web driver API can handle repetitive tasks involving human-system interaction. We’ll explore common use cases for Selenium, followed by its integration into performance testing. Beyond testing, can Selenium automate tasks like Admin updates, maintenance, reporting, or even shopping? From personal experience, he will outline automating desktop apps and addressing challenges.

We’ll go further by showcasing how we used Selenium to create a DIY RPA tool, automating the Oracle ADFDI plugin for Excel.

Takeaways from the talk:

  • Broaden the audience’s mindset to look for various applications of Selenium and system automation in general.
